§ 21061.1. — 21061.1. (Added by Stats. 1976, Ch. 1312.)
California·Code PRC Public Resources Code - PRC·Div. 13. DIVISION 13. ENVIRONMENTAL QUALITY·Ch. 2.5. CHAPTER 2.5. Definitions
“Feasible” means capable of being accomplished in a successful manner within a reasonable period of time, taking into account economic, environmental, social, and technological factors.
